Borussia Dortmund have yet to contact FC Porto over Pietuszewski

Oskar Pietuszewski was linked last Thursday with a possible transfer during the upcoming summer window. German outlet Fussballdaten reported that Borussia Dortmund were interested in signing the young player and could soon take “concrete steps” to move the deal forward.
According to the same publication, the German club, the current Bundesliga runners-up, had already begun contacts with the representatives of the 18-year-old footballer. The aim would be to learn about his “future plans and career goals”, as well as to present him with the plan outlined for his development.
However, newspaper O Jogo wrote this Friday that the board led by André Villas-Boas has so far received no contact or request for information regarding the forward. As such, the possibility of the player changing clubs is not, for now, on the table.
Pietuszewski arrived at the Estádio do Dragão in January this year from Jagiellonia Bialystok in a deal valued at around ten million euros. The agreement also included bonuses tied to the achievement of certain objectives, although their exact amount was never disclosed.
The Polish club also retained the right to 10% of any future capital gain resulting from the player’s sale. Pietuszewski, for his part, initially signed a contract valid until 5 January 2029, the maximum term allowed by FIFA regulations for underage footballers.
After coming of age in May and helping the team coached by Italian manager Francesco Farioli win the national championship, the youngster renewed his deal with FC Porto. The new contract extended his stay until 30 June 2031 and kept the release clause at 60 million euros.
